Adding a Touch of Flavor; Coriander & Turmeric



Spices are no longer confined to the Indian cuisines but today, spices have found their use in dishes all around the world. And not just dishes, spices like coriander and turmeric are being widely used and recognized for their beneficial properties too like having excellent medicinal values, being anti bacterial in nature and being used in the manufacture of drinks, beverages and perfumes too.

Indian foods are known worldwide for their distinct spicy flavor. This is the one quality that sets apart the Indian cuisines from the other cuisines of the world. Spices have been an indispensable part of the Indian recipes and a dish is considered to be incomplete without these spices. In fact, India is often referred to as the home of spices. The rich and exotic flavors of the Indian cuisines are attributed to the presence of spices. There are approximately 80 varieties of spices that are grown across the globe but India alone is the growing place for almost 50 of these spices.

Some of the widely known and used spices are turmeric, chilly, garlic, ginger, coriander, cardamom, celery, fenugreek, cumin, cinnamon, ajwain, cloves etc. Each of these spices has a distinct flavor that it imparts to the food that it is added to. Apart from having the culinary benefits, the spices have many other advantages too like a lot of spices have excellent medicinal properties while some spices act as aphrodisiacs. The spices act as germ fighters in our body, are used as preservatives and often occupy an important place in few religious ceremonies and customs too. One of the very popular kinds of spice is turmeric. Commonly known as haldi, turmeric is a rhizome or an underground stem of a plant that resembles a ginger plant. The rhizomes of the turmeric plant are generally ground to form a fine, bright yellow powder and it is in this form that most of the turmeric finds use. The turmeric is also used in the rhizome form in some cases.

India is the world’s largest producer of turmeric. Turmeric has a wide variety of uses. The use of turmeric as a spice and for adding flavor to the dishes has been known since ancient days. Apart from its use in flavoring, turmeric also finds use in making medicines, liquors, cosmetics and toiletries. Turmeric is also used as a natural colorant. Its use as an antiseptic and in blood purification has been known too. Another important spice is the coriander also known as dhania popularly. Coriander is obtained in its dried form as a fruit of an herbaceous plant of the parsley family that grows annually. The coriander is used commonly as a curry powder and in soups and stews. Coriander is also used in the manufacture of several beverages and perfumes. Its use as an aromatic stimulant and high anti bacterial property account for its popularity too.
